Responsibilities:

  • You general accountability for plant reliability performance in all plants in the AP Region (9 plants). Specific accountability to follow specific strategies to improve plant reliability  performance and the related services available at the plant level.
  • You will continuously work with the plant engineering teams to improve workplace safety, quality, and equipment reliability & availability, in an environment free of accidents emphasizing safety as a value.
  • You are responsible to lead the RE pillar at regional level and ensure the implementation of systems and processes according to the methodology of Plant Optimization, ensuring standardization and tracking processes across the regional footprint.
  • You need to support and update performance scorecards to visually demonstrate gains in the space of reliability, safety and energy conservation.
  • You are also request to support compliance activities at plant level using guidelines of EHS&S Management, Quality Systems, Corporate and Legal requirements, following the standards and policies established, as well commitment to high standards of business conduct and Ethical behavior.

Goodyear is one of the world’s largest tire companies. It employs about 74,000 people and manufactures its products in 57 facilities in 23 countries around the world. Its two Innovation Centers in Akron, Ohio and Colmar-Berg, Luxembourg strive to develop state-of-the-art products and services that set the technology and performance standard for the industry.
